Rally for the Flag

Busybodies in Fairfax County government recently wanted to limit the number and size of flags that homeowners can lawfully fly. This anti-freedom measure was not endorsed by the county planning commission (following a media firestorm and grassroots backlash). However, the Fairfax County Board of Supervisors could still revive it.

Board Chairman Jeff McKay (D-Lee) seemed keen on the draft flag regulations in a statement issued to Fox News. “The proposed ordinance aims to allow residents to still fly flags proudly with reasonable guidelines, while protecting everyone’s First Amendment rights,” McKay said.

The Fairfax GOP has organized a rally against new flag regulations, to be held this Monday, March 8 at 5:30 PM outside the Fairfax County Government Center (1200 Government Center Parkway). Rally attendees will gather in the main circle, and are encouraged to bring their flags.
